Bill History
2025-05-02Governor
Signed by the Governor
2025-04-30Senate
FINALLY PASSED - 2/3 Elected Required, in concurrence.
2025-04-29House
In accordance with Section 23 of Article IX of the Constitution, a two-thirds vote of all the members elected to the House was necessary. FINALLY PASSED . Sent for concurrence. ORDERED SENT FORTHWITH.
2025-04-22Committee
Reported Out; OTP-AM
2025-03-06Committee
Work Session Held
2025-03-06Committee
Voted; OTP-AM
2025-02-27Committee
Work Session Held; TABLED
2025-02-06Committee
Referred to Committee on Agriculture, Conservation and Forestry.

H.P. 320 - L.D. 491
Resolve, Requiring the Director of the Bureau of Parks and Lands to Convey
Certain Real Property in the Town of Richmond
Preamble. The Constitution of Maine, Article IX, Section 23 requires that real estate
held by the State for conservation or recreation purposes may not be reduced or its uses
substantially altered except on the vote of 2/3 of all members elected to each House; and
Whereas, certain real estate authorized for conveyance by this resolve is under the
designations described in the Maine Revised Statutes, Title 12, section 598-A; and
Whereas, the Director of the Bureau of Parks and Lands within the Department of
Agriculture, Conservation and Forestry may sell, lease or exchange lands with the approval
of the Legislature in accordance with the Maine Revised Statutes, Title 12, sections 1814,
1837 and 1851; now, therefore, be it
Sec. 1. Director of Bureau of Parks and Lands directed to convey certain
land in Town of Richmond. Resolved: That, notwithstanding any provision of law to
the contrary, the Director of the Bureau of Parks and Lands within the Department of
Agriculture, Conservation and Forestry shall by quitclaim deed and without covenant
convey the State's interest in property described in section 2 to Wilhelmine Dennis Oakes
or the estate of Wilhelmine Dennis Oakes. Any legal or closing costs of the conveyance
may not be paid by the bureau.
Sec. 2. Property interests to be conveyed. Resolved: That the property required
to be conveyed pursuant to section 1 is a parcel of land of approximately 7 acres with
improvements thereon, located in the Town of Richmond and shown as Lot 67 on Map R6
of the Town of Richmond tax assessor maps.
